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31742846 848 81 78109526829
37 5465 90917922961
37 5465 90917922961
05169786265 3040008 47773
All about undefined
Interested in learning more?
37 5465 90917922961
05169786265 3040008 47773
See more
592434525 31165899289
58 0804 3960671
See more
18273 02120524230 1320780
8282566454 77454493 93
See more